There may be a different explanation for this. I have a Daedric Bow that has a rating of 143 and the moment I start wearing my "Fortify Archery Helmet", the rating rises to 205. The helmet increases the damage done with a bow with 43% and if I multiply 143 with 1.43 it turns out to be 204.49. My Daedric Sword has a rating of 106 and when I start wearing my "Fortify One-Handed Gauntlets" the rating is increased to 152. The gauntlets enhance one-handed with 43% as well and 106 times 1.43 is 151.58. Armor ratings seems to work in a similar fashion after the latest patch. I have the "Well fitted" perk which increases the rating for heavy armor with 25% if you wear armor, helmet, gauntlets and boots of the "heavy armor type" at the same time. If I drop one of those, let's say the helmet, the armor rating of the items I'm still wearing decrease with 25%. Curiously enough the armor rating of the shield decreases with 25% as well. - Armor 473 ---> 378 - Helmet 233 ---> 186 - Gauntlets 215 --> 172 - Boots 215 ---> 172 - Shield 138 ---> 110 If you do the math, you'll see that the drop in ratings is 25%. My guess is that they started to incorporate the effects of additional enhancements in the actual rating number for weapons and armor. Bioy
